*Join Harry Potter on the magical journey of a lifetime in the second book in J.K. Rowling's multi-award-winning series.

Harry Potter's summer has included the worst birthday ever, doomy warnings from a house-elf called Dobby and rescue from the Dursleys by his friend Ron Weasley in a magical flying car! Back at Hogwarts School of Witchcraft and Wizardry for his second year, Harry hears strange whispers echo through empty corridors - and then the attacks start. Students are found as though turned to stone ... Dobby's sinister predictions seem to be coming true.

J.K. Rowling's internationally bestselling Harry Potter books continue to captivate new generations of readers. Harry's second adventure alongside his friends, Ron and Hermione, invites you to explore even more of the wizarding world; from the waving, walloping branches of the Whomping Willow to the thrills of a rain-streaked Quidditch pitch. This gorgeous paperback edition features a spectacular cover by award-winning artist Jonny Duddle, plus refreshed bonus material, allowing readers to learn about wand woods and get to know the many members of the Weasley family. Perfect for anyone who's ready to lose themselves in the biggest children's books of all time.
